A field of 36 Seniors took part in the November Medal. Conditions were ideal apart from a little rain for the late starters, writes Janet Dack.
Four players managed to beat the 70 barrier with the winner Iain Bain(14) scoring a nett 65, three shots ahead of runner-up Keith Wilson (12) who recorded a 68 nett. Two players had 69 nett, with third place on countback going to Alan Vincent (19) whose score was boosted by a magnificent two at the 350 yard 17th - the only two of the day! Sid Pember (19) was the player to miss out on the prizes.
?First division winner of the men’s October Medal was Andrew Hellier (8) with a nett 68.
Second place went to Paul Curtin (11) with a nett 73 beating Craig Trivett (11) on count back.
Division two winner, with an excellent nett 63, was Andy Gabb (16). Simon Palmer (15) claimed second place with a nett 67 beating Mike Rymer (14) on count back.
Luckily this Wednesday the weather was fine and the ladies were able to compete for a EWGA medal. The joint winners were Janet Dack and Pauline Willis.
